I just had my 360 flashed with the latest firmware (plays MLB 2K9, etc.) Had a Cyberhome DVD drive and could not get a game to burn successfully. Bought my buddies exact Lite-On drive that he makes his copies with as well as his Kreon drive to backup my originals. Every game he made with the Lite-On works flawlessly on my 360, yet I cannot get any of my burns to work.
I am using the same media (Memorex DL) that he used on the games that play fine. I am using the same utility program (IMGBurn) and have even tried Clone Cd. I have been burning at 2.4X and I am still making coasters. Just for kicks I tried to up the speed to 4X on a burn and it loaded successfully in my 360. Trying it again later it would not load on repeated attempts. It (and all of my failed burns)will take a long time with the drive apparently trying to read the disc and then ultimately prompt me to hit "A" to open the drive. It never says it cannot read it or it is dirty. I am going nuts and wonder what to do?

Has that "image" ever worked? You need a known good image to burn and test.. copying faulty low quality disks which don't work is a waste of time...
Also burner brand makes a huge difference.. not much point using a burner from before the pioneer112d.. my nec3550 makes flawless burns but they will not read on a 360.
Make sure nothing else is going on during burning.. screensaver cutting in, antivirus updating.. anything like that will screw it up.
